92.68 percent of the population in 21132 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 36.82 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 27.43 percent of the residents in 21132 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.86 members with about 2.51 cars available per household.
An estimate of 96.82 percent of the residents in 21132 has some form of health insurance. 17.11 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 89.37 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 21132 would have to travel an average of 29.79 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Northwest Hospital Center .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 21132, Pylesville, Maryland.

As of , an estimate of 3,115 residents live in 21132 with a median age of 38.9 years. 30.53 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 10.85 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 44.51 percent of the residents in 21132 is currently married, and 15.70 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 21132 is $11,514.25.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 21132 is approximately $2,344. The median household spends about 20.36 percent of their income on housing.
